RE: In einem vHost verschiedene Accounts
Hallo Christian, Hallo Liste
Hallo, ja leider, die Rede ist dennoch von Plesk. Habe soeben versucht eine Sub-Domain anzulegen. Man kann zwar durch anlegen eines Sub-Domains auch einen FTP-Nutzer anlegen, diese erhält jedoch einen
eigenen, neuen httpdocs Ordner und nicht denselben httpdocs Ordner im vHost. Wie auch immer, ich müsste mich dann so wie es aussieht in Yast2 oder useradd einarbeiten müssen.
Die Einarbeitung in YaST2 sollte nicht allzu schwer sein ;-)
In der Rubrik "Sicherheit und Benutzer" gibt es u. a. den Menüpunkt "Benutzer bearbeiten und anlegen". Der zusätzliche FTP-User muss die gleiche Gruppenzugehörigkeiten haben wie die vorhandenen Benutzer. Die einfachste Lösung ist wohl, den User per Plesk ("Subdomain") anzulegen und in YaST nur das Homeverzeichnis zu ändern.
Hallo, vielen Dank für deine Hilfestellung. Habe es auch gleich probiert. Das Yast sieht Recht easy aus, hoffentlich kann man da aber nicht schnell vieles verbocken ;) Habe unter Plesk die SubDomain erstellt und unter YaST auf Benutzer bearbeiten und anlegen. Da bräuchte ich praktisch die letzten zwei Ordner der Subdomain (/home/httpd/vhosts/yamuk.com/subdomains/blabla) löschen, somit hätte dieser FTP-Nutzer dann einen eigenen FTP Zugang auf die gleichen Dateien. Es kommt dann aber die Fehlermeldung: Das Home-Verzeichniss wird von einem anderen Benutzer verwendet. Bitte versuchen Sie es erneut. Wenn ich jedoch nur den httpdocs Ordner des Home-Verzeichnisse nehme, funktioniert es. Würde vorerst auch für meine Bedürfnisse ausreichen. Gut wäre hier, wenn man gleich zwei oder drei Bereiche einem User vom Home-Verzeichniss freischalten lassen könnte. Das wichtigere ist nun die DB. Man kann unter Plesk zwar mehrere User für eine Datenbank anlegen. Nur kann man nicht direkt über eine URL zu phpMyAdmin. Es erscheint dann immer das Plesk-Login, wo ich für das Home-Verzeichniss, das eingerichtete vHost und somit die Datenbank, eben nur einen Zugang habe. Wenn man direkt in phpmyAdmin, (WebAdmin) zugreifen könnte, dann könnten sich die User separat einloggen, was eine feinere Lösung wäre, wenn man mehrere Programmierer an seinem Server (unter der gleichen vHost) arbeiten lässt. Viele Grüße aus Stuttgart Taner
Hallo Taner, hallo Leute, Am Freitag, 20. Januar 2006 00:07 schrieb Taner Ayaydin: [Homeverzeichnis eines Benutzers ändern]
Die Einarbeitung in YaST2 sollte nicht allzu schwer sein ;-)
In der Rubrik "Sicherheit und Benutzer" gibt es u. a. den Menüpunkt "Benutzer bearbeiten und anlegen". Der zusätzliche FTP-User muss die gleiche Gruppenzugehörigkeiten haben wie die vorhandenen Benutzer. Die einfachste Lösung ist wohl, den User per Plesk ("Subdomain") anzulegen und in YaST nur das Homeverzeichnis zu ändern.
Hallo, vielen Dank für deine Hilfestellung. Habe es auch gleich probiert. Das Yast sieht Recht easy aus, hoffentlich kann man da aber nicht schnell vieles verbocken ;) Habe unter Plesk die SubDomain erstellt und unter YaST auf Benutzer bearbeiten und anlegen. Da bräuchte ich praktisch die letzten zwei Ordner der Subdomain (/home/httpd/vhosts/yamuk.com/subdomains/blabla) löschen, somit hätte dieser FTP-Nutzer dann einen eigenen FTP Zugang auf die gleichen Dateien. Es kommt dann aber die Fehlermeldung: Das Home-Verzeichniss wird von einem anderen Benutzer verwendet. Bitte versuchen Sie es erneut. Wenn
Nette Überprüfung durch YaST - wenn auch in diesem Fall eher hinderlich.
ich jedoch nur den httpdocs Ordner des Home-Verzeichnisse nehme, funktioniert es. Würde vorerst auch für meine Bedürfnisse ausreichen. Gut wäre hier, wenn man gleich zwei oder drei Bereiche einem User vom Home-Verzeichniss freischalten lassen könnte.
Dir bleibt immer noch der Aufruf von usermod, um das Homeverzeichnis zu ändern - mit etwas Glück prüft das nicht auf Duplikate. Details siehe man usermod
Wenn man direkt in phpmyAdmin, (WebAdmin) zugreifen könnte, dann könnten sich die User separat einloggen, was eine feinere Lösung wäre, wenn man mehrere Programmierer an seinem Server (unter der gleichen vHost) arbeiten lässt.
Sehe ich das Problem gerade nicht? phpMyAdmin besteht "nur" aus einer Ladung PHP-Scripte - Du bist nicht auf das Exemplar von Plesk angewiesen. Installier Dir das phpMyAdmin-Paket von SUSE und leg in der Apache-Config einen Alias zu /srv/www/phpMyAdmin/ an. Oder, noch einfacher, dafür aber ohne Sicherheitsupdates per YOU, lade Dir phpMyAdmin runter und lege alles ins httpdocs-Verzeichnis eines beliebigen vHosts. Ach ja, in der Konfiguration solltest Du zumindest die Loginmethode anpassen - Details in der Dokumentation von phpMyAdmin. Gruß Christian Boltz -- Einen "RL'schen Aufkleber" mit dem Hinweis "Werbung einwerfen verboten" irgendwo in Usenet zu posten, hat rechtlich die gleiche Wirkung wie im fahlen Mondenschein unter 1.000jährigen Eichen nackt einen Ausdruckstanz gegen Spam aufzuführen... [Joerg Heidrich in d.a.n-a.m]
participants (2)
-
Christian Boltz
-
Taner Ayaydin